Keep character small and you may sweet.

“It’s important to feel small and also to the idea,” O’Connor said. “It’s also important to remember that there can be a fine line anywhere between also boring and you will also playful in which the entire profile was an effective lot of laughs.”

A great guideline will be to pursue a plan composed of the Brian Howie, the latest machine and blogger of your Higher Love Argument.

“The character must have three things need individuals pick away about you, several things you intend to see in all of them, and another topic you hope to discover to each other: ‘I are A beneficial, B, C, interested in X, Y, let us run around the nation and find or manage Z,'” Howie said.

Add an image of an attraction you really have otherwise would like having.

This is something, centered on O’Connor – from golf, cooking, otherwise garden to Disneyland, art, drink, or pet. Aligning photo that have interests might ensure it is easier for anybody else to begin with a conversation to you.
